Budacki's Drive In
Nestled at 4739 N Damen Ave, Chicago, Budacki's Drive In has been serving up no-frills, delicious food for decades. This unpretentious spot is a favorite among locals for its comforting menu, fast service, and welcoming atmosphere. Whether you're a long-time resident or just passing through, this is one of those places where a single visit often turns into a regular habit.
A Menu That Speaks for Itself
When it comes to Chicago-style fast food, Budacki’s delivers exactly what you crave. Their menu is centered around hot dogs, burgers, and sandwiches, with options like classic hot dogs, chili-cheese dogs, and corn dogs making frequent appearances in customer orders. Beyond the drive-in staples, Budacki’s also offers Korean-inspired dishes, including the highly praised Seoul Steak Bowl, featuring marinated beef over rice with a bold Atomic Sauce. The balance between American comfort food and global flavors keeps both regulars and first-time visitors intrigued.
A Dining Experience Tailored for Everyone
Budacki’s is more than just a quick bite—it's a versatile dining destination. The restaurant offers takeout, delivery, and drive-thru options, making it incredibly convenient for those on the go. For those who prefer to stay and enjoy their meal, outdoor seating is available, including heated and covered areas, perfect for Chicago’s unpredictable weather. Families and groups feel at home here, with moderate noise levels and a casual, divey charm that welcomes all ages.
